Understanding Number Frequency

In a fair lottery like Mega-Sena, each number should theoretically be drawn with equal probability over time. With 6 numbers drawn from 1-60in each draw, the expected frequency for each number can be calculated mathematically.

However, in any finite sample of draws, some variation from the expected frequency is normal and expected. This variation decreases proportionally as more draws occur (Law of Large Numbers), but short-term deviations are statistically expected and do not indicate any bias in the draw process.

Mathematical Expectation vs. Reality

For Mega-Sena, the mathematical expected frequency for each number can be calculated as:

Expected Frequency = (Number of Draws) × (6 / 60)

Actual frequencies will vary from this expected value. Numbers appearing significantly more often than expected are considered "hot," while those appearing less often are "cold." However, these labels describe past performance only and have no bearing on future draws.
